I have 2007 / 2.3l Saab 9-5 Automatic. When I switch to M (manual) and press the "-/+" shift won't change. When I press "-" it will volume down the radio. When I press "+" it will shift down. When I press the volume down key on the steering wheel it will switch to "aux".
Looks like all my buttons are messed up on the steering wheel. Do you have any idea /solutions?

It could be a bad clock spring cable in the steering wheel or something else faulty/misconfigured. Take it to a dealer and this is something they should address for free.
